Hello everyone! Some of you may remember me from the past with my dwarf seahorse set up. I had kept them for a steady 9 months happily until a massive outbreak of hydroids and a new cycle occurring after panacur treatments. I was extremely upset and very frustrated. After now ... 4 months without them, I cannot bear it any longer!
I went out today and purchased a 5gal Marineland Hex Tank, tons of artificial "Corkscrew Vals" (closest looking artificial plant to eel grass),a very fine gravel, a new heater, etc.
I plan to do this tank differently than I did in the past. I'm going for a "sterile" sort of thing. No liverock, live macro's, inverts, etc. All of which i had in the previous tank which very much so was probably the source of hydroids.
I plan to set the tank up within the next 2-3 weeks and let it run empty till spring (April or so) before I go ahead and place an order of dwarfs.
After keeping everything from fish-only to full blown reef - I can say that nothing is more rewarding for me than keeping dwarf seahorses.
